  • the invention relates to a washing machine with swinging components, especially tubs, to which ballast bodies are attached and ballast bodies therefor.
  • EP 0 825 291 A1 discloses a disc-shaped and approximately circular weighting weight attached to the bottom of the tub made of a material mixture, not specified, presumably concrete, with a density> 2 g / cm 3 . It lies on three in a plane parallel to the main level of the floor on contact surfaces and is held by tabs that are spaced apart in a circle perpendicular to the main level and are tensioned from the outside by a folded strap against the narrow wall surface of the weight.
  • Suds container attached concrete weight disclosed as weight, in which a metal outer tire is still cast in the weight.
  • EP 0 798 412 A2 also discloses a body filled with concrete, which has openings into which a partly frictional, partly positive connection in the manner of a
  • Expansion dowels can be used for a screw connection that holds the ballast weight on the washing machine.
  • a ballast weight for the front surfaces of washing machine tubs with a washing drum rotating about a horizontal axis which consists of concrete or an agglomerate, in particular a metal-plastic agglomerate and has a curved outer surface at least on the outside, with on of the inside facing the tub surfaces are arranged in such a way that their shape is complementary to the corresponding end face of the tub, so that a stable attachment of the weight is possible.
  • EP 0 417460 A2 discloses a washing machine with components for attaching weighting bodies or weighting bodies themselves, which are made from reactive resin concrete (polymer concrete) containing thermosets. It is also mentioned that the weight of the component is due to the inclusion of denser ones
  • Aggregates such as B. scrap iron can be increased. This is intended to produce a variable density, that is to say a variable weight, for the various application purposes.
  • the production times and costs of such components are also high in mass production, since temperature-dependent pot times and curing times have to be taken into account.

  • the further solution provides a ballast body for washing machines, in particular for attachment to suds containers, with material parts made of plastic and iron material, which was produced by injection molding and has a density> 2.4 g / cm 3 ; it consists of a thermoplastic with substantial fillings of hematite and / or magnetite.
  • the iron material is then introduced into a mold before injection molding or pressing, preferably a pure ore made of hematite or magnetite or mixtures of the two in the smallest possible granular form, which do not hinder the pressing or injection molding process.
  • a pure ore made of hematite or magnetite or mixtures of the two in the smallest possible granular form which do not hinder the pressing or injection molding process.
  • very granular metal components can also be used. Tests have shown that mill scale, which in addition to parts of Fe 2 0 3 and Fe 3 0 4 also contains parts of FeO and impurities, could also be used, but the pure ores are preferred.
  • thermoplastics have a specific weight or a density of 0.9-1.0 g / cm 3
  • hematite and magnetite have a density of about 5.2-5.3 g / cm 3
  • metal components are completely enclosed by the thermoplastics, so that after the process a completely homogeneous body with a plastic surface is present.
  • the specific weight or the density of> 2.4 g / cm 3 the density of the specific weight or the density of> 2.4 g / cm 3 .
  • Hematite fractions or magnetite fractions or mixtures of these have a volume fraction of 35 - 70% in the body, which leads to a specific weight leads, which according to the inventors' experiments should be between 2.5-3.9 g / cm 3 , but preferably 2.9-3.5 g / cm 3 . This is a compromise in the amount of metal component parts to be added because of the good processability z. B. in an extrusion machine with a corresponding shape that is tailored to the dimensions of the ballast body.

  • a tub 2 of a front loading washing machine with front loading opening 21 is equipped with a ballast weight 1 around this front opening.
  • the weight 1 has different recesses 15. From its top, the weight can be connected to the tub 2 through corresponding openings 13.
  • FIG 2 is a perspective view of the tub similar to Figure 1, but with weight 1 removed.
  • the outer contours 232, 242 of the fastening elements 23, 24 lie both on the outside of the tub and on the side which is assigned to the front loading opening 21 on a circular line, as a result of which the ballast weight 1 is loaded evenly.
  • the principle of the invention is that the recesses or openings on the ballast weight that are complementary to the outer contours lie closely on their surface against the outer contours 232 in order to bring the main part of the load onto the outer contours 232 of the fastening elements. A necessary positive connection of the ballast weight 1 with the tub 2 can then be distributed over a few screw domes 233.
  • the rib structure or honeycomb structure of the fastening elements can be clearly seen.
  • the calculation of the force vectors has shown that such a structure ensures optimal conditions for the transmission of the occurring moments or loads without having any disadvantages in terms of injection technology.
  • the tub is preferably made of plastic such as polyethylene or polypropylene, so that both the tub and the load weight, which is shown in isolation in Figure 3, preferably have the same surfaces.
